MAERSK launches new air cargo business

-

Maersk announces Maersk Air Cargo as the company´s main air freight offering serving the logistics needs of its clients with integrated logistics. At the same time, Maersk chooses Denmark’s second largest airport, Billund, as its air freight hub for Maersk Air Cargo with daily flights, creating several jobs in the region. To this end, Maersk Air Cargo has announced its intent to enter into an agreement with the Flight Personnel Union which is a part of the Danish Confederat­ion and Trade Unions (FH). “Air freight is a crucial enabler of flexibilit­y and agility in global supply chains as it allows our customers to tackle time-critical supply chain challenges and provides transport mode options for high value cargo,” said Aymeric Chandavoin­e, Global Head of Logistics and Services, AP Moller Maersk.
